Descendants of Edward Bradbury

Generation No. 17


      180. Charles Edward17 Bradbury (John Thomas16, Edwin15, Thomas14, Jacob13, Thomas12, Jacob11, William10, Thomas9, Wymond8, William7, Matthew6, William5, Robert4, William3, Robert2, Edward1)747,748,749,750 was born August 19, 1866 in Hermon, Penobscot, ME751, and died November 10, 1935 in Bangor, Penobscot, ME752. He married Georgiana M. Perkins753,754,755,756,757 April 10, 1889 in Bangor, Penobscot, ME758, daughter of Frank Perkins and Julia McCosker. She was born November 25, 1874 in Bangor, Penobscot, ME759, and died November 01, 1931 in Bangor, Penobscot, ME759.

Notes for Charles Edward Bradbury:
Obituary in Bangor daily News Nov 11, 1935

"Chas. E. Bradbury
Well Known Citizen For many Years In Trucking Business

The death of Charles E Bradbury 69, occurred Sunday at his home 52 Curve Street. He had been in impaired health for a long time. He was born in hermon but lived in Bangor nearly all his life.

He had been in the general trucking business for the past 45 years at one time having 48 men in his employ and 20 at the time of his death. He was most highly regarded by all who knew him for high integrity, an able business man and a good citizen in every way.

Besides his business he had considerable holdings in real estate, He was a member of the Coulubia Street Baptist Church and of the Order of the Golden Cross.

His wife, Mrs Georgia M Bradbury died recently. Surviving are his son Fred C Bradbury and his daughter Mrs Annie Silke; the gransons, Charles E of Brewer, Fred C, Jr. of Bangor and granddaughter, Thelma M Silke. Mrs Dorothy Chase Tower of New Haven Conn and Theodore Chase of Hampden were brought up in the family.

Funeral services will be at the late residence 52 Curve Street Tuesday afternoon at two o'clock"

Notes for Georgiana M. Perkins:
Obituary from Nov 2, 1931 Bangor Daily News:

"Many friends will deeply regret the passing of Mrs. Georgia M. Bradbury, wife of Charles E. Bradbury, which occurred Sunday afternoon at her home 52 Curve Street after a brief illness, at the age of 58 years. Left in the family besides her husband are her son and daughter , Frederick C. Bradbury and Mrs. James J. Silke both of Bangor and her foster children brought up as her own Theodore Chase and Mrs. Dorothy Power, now of New Haven Conn.; also a brother Nicolas Perkins of Bangor; a grand-daughter, Miss Thelma Silke and two grandsons, Charles and (Frederick) Clayton Bradbury (Jr). An aunt, Mrs. Georgia Cowles, formerly of New Haven, Conn, now 88 years of age has lived in the family for the past five years. There are several cousins.

Mrs. Bradbury attended the Universalist Church. She was a member of Excelsior Rebekah lodge, the Ladies Auxillary, Oriental Lodge N.E.O.P., United Order of the Golden Cross and Harmony Camp R.N. of A. In all of which she was a most valued member. Of a kindly and sympathetic disposition, much devoted to her family and loyal to her friends, she will be much missed and mourned. The time of the funeral will be announced."

      182. Elnora Lee17 Bradbury (John Thomas16, Edwin15, Thomas14, Jacob13, Thomas12, Jacob11, William10, Thomas9, Wymond8, William7, Matthew6, William5, Robert4, William3, Robert2, Edward1)765 was born September 26, 1875 in Hermon, ME766,767,768,769, and died April 22, 1916 in Malden, MA770,771,772. She married Frank Thomas Hutchinson773 November 09, 1909 in Malden, MA774, son of Lemuel Hutchinson and Catherine Spear. He was born August 22, 1866 in Worcester, VT775, and died April 13, 1949 in Littleton, MA775,776.

More About Elnora Lee Bradbury:
Burial: Worester, VT Hutchinson Family Plot777
Cause of Death: Bright's disease
Medical Information: Died of nine month illness @ 40

Notes for Frank Thomas Hutchinson:
From Obituary: "...died at his home, Dell Dale farm, on Great Road, Route 2, Littleton, yesterday morning, following an illness of several weeks..... a resident of the community for the past 32 years, was one of the largest and best-known dairy farm operators in New England, being milk supplier to a large restaurant chain and other retailers....He was an attendant of the First Congregational-Unitarian church of Littleton..."

More About Frank Thomas Hutchinson:
Burial: Worester, VT Hutchinson Family Plot777

Marriage Notes for Elnora Bradbury and Frank Hutchinson:
Married at Mothers home by Rev. Richard Eddy Sykes, D.D. of First universalist Church. Moved to Worcester, MA following marriage.
